无水印Aspose Word转PDF教程及工具下载
下载需积分: 50 | ZIP格式 | 14.68MB |
更新于2025-02-12
| 155 浏览量 | 举报
在介绍如何使用Aspose Cells for Java将Word文档转换为PDF格式之前,我们首先需要了解Aspose Cells for Java是一款用于操作Microsoft Excel文件的强大Java库。但是,本篇文档的重点是转换Word文档为PDF格式,这通常通过Aspose Words for Java来实现。Aspose Words for Java同样是一款功能丰富的库,可以用来创建、修改、转换甚至渲染Word文档。
### 知识点一:Aspose Words for Java简介
Aspose Words for Java是Aspose公司的产品,它允许Java开发者在不安装Microsoft Word的情况下处理Word文档。它支持多种文档操作,包括但不限于文档创建、内容插入、格式化、文本编辑以及将Word文档转换成PDF等其他格式。
### 知识点二:实现Word转PDF的功能
要将Word文档转换为PDF格式,开发者需要在项目中加入Aspose Words for Java的jar包作为依赖。这可以通过Maven或手动方式完成。在Maven项目中,通常需要在pom.xml文件中添加相关的依赖项。
### 知识点三:依赖管理(Maven)
Maven是一个项目管理和自动化构建工具,它使用一个名为pom.xml的项目对象模型文件。通过pom.xml文件,Maven可以管理项目的构建、报告和文档。对于本例,使用Maven来管理Aspose Words for Java的依赖,开发者仅需添加相应的依赖配置,Maven便会自动下载所需的jar包。
### 知识点四:去除水印的方法
在某些情况下,转换得到的PDF文档中可能会包含水印。通常,这是由Word文档本身的格式决定的。如果想要在转换过程中去除水印,可能需要修改Aspose Words库中的相关设置或通过编写代码覆盖原有的水印设置。这通常需要深入库内部的API进行定制化开发。
### 知识点五:代码实现(Java)
为了完成Word到PDF的转换,需要编写Java代码,调用Aspose Words提供的API。代码中会涉及到加载Word文档、设置转换参数和执行转换操作。示例代码如下:
```java
// 引入Aspose Words命名空间
import com.aspose.words.Document;
import com.aspose.words.SaveFormat;
import com.aspose.words.SaveOptions;
public class WordToPDF {
public static void main(String[] args) {
// 加载Word文档
Document doc = new Document("path/to/your/document.docx");
// 设置保存选项以确保输出PDF没有水印
SaveOptions saveOptions = new SaveOptions(SaveFormat.PDF);
// 指定输出的PDF文件路径
String outPath = "path/to/your/output.pdf";
// 执行转换操作并保存为PDF
doc.save(outPath, saveOptions);
System.out.println("Word文档已成功转换为PDF格式。");
}
}
```
在代码中,`SaveOptions`是一个重要的类,它允许开发者定制转换过程。如果需要去除水印,可能需要设置特定的选项,这可能需要查阅Aspose的官方文档来获取具体的API使用信息。
### 知识点六:Aspose开源许可证和使用限制
虽然Aspose提供了试用版本,但是它并非完全免费。对于商业用途,需要购买相应的许可证。开源许可证通常适用于个人学习、研究以及非商业用途。本压缩包中包含的jar包和相关代码示例仅适用于学习研究,使用时应避免侵犯版权并遵守Aspose的开源协议。
### 知识点七:附录:压缩包内容说明
压缩包“Word2pdf”内可能包含以下文件和目录:
- `aspose-words-javadoc.jar`: Aspose Words for Java的API文档文件。
- `aspose-words-x.x.x.jar`: Aspose Words for Java的库文件。
- `maven-repo`: 存放maven依赖的目录,其中的pom文件定义了项目的依赖关系。
- `example.java`: 示例代码文件,展示如何使用Aspose Words库将Word文档转换为PDF。
在使用时,需要将`aspose-words-javadoc.jar`和`aspose-words-x.x.x.jar`文件添加到项目的类路径中,然后在代码中引用相应的类和方法。如果项目使用Maven管理依赖,则需要在`pom.xml`中添加相应的依赖项。
注意:本知识点说明仅为可能的内容,实际压缩包内容以提供的文件为准。
上述内容介绍了使用Aspose Words for Java进行Word转PDF操作所需的知识点。如要使用,请确保遵守相关版权规定和开源协议。
相关推荐


1375 浏览量







墨封
- 粉丝: 0
最新资源
- 获取《JavaScript权威指南》第5版完整源代码
- 教培机构学员管理系统实现高效学员管理与智能排课
- 深入解析PTC Windchill性能优化与代码实践
- 易语言实现实时获取北京时间的教程
- ESET杀毒工具:高效清除各类电脑病毒
- 在UIWebView中实现点击链接与GIF动画显示技巧
- 蝙蝠算法在数据聚类中的应用及Matlab实现
- 掌握Android技术:官方帮助文档要点解析
- 完美实现仿新浪微博的TAB底部导航布局
- jQuery.artZoom 插件:实现图片的旋转放大效果
- 有趣的Whack-A-Bot Chrome扩展:打击机器人游戏体验
- 探索LSB算法在BMP图像信息隐藏中的应用
- 诺基亚5230个性化时间屏保:MojosDesignClockv1.0.0
- VB+Access构建的酒店管理信息系统
- SQLServer服务管理及桌面快捷方式美化
- MLTBLOCK Chrome扩展:个性化屏蔽MLTSHップ用户内容